Beijing Launches Dedicated Insurance for Intelligent New Energy Vehicles
[Policy Update] Beijing has taken the lead nationwide in initiating the development and application of commercial insurance tailored for intelligent connected new energy vehicles.
Core Development: Insurance Covering All Levels from L2 to L4 Autonomous Driving to Be Implemented Soon
The Beijing Municipal Financial Regulatory Bureau announced on March 29, 2026, at the Zhongguancun Forum the launch of dedicated insurance development aimed at addressing the gap in existing auto insurance policies, which currently fail to cover risks unique to autonomous driving. The new product will be an optimized version of the current new energy vehicle insurance, uniformly compatible with intelligent connected vehicles across all autonomy levels from L2 to L4.
Key Details: Broader Coverage and Higher Limits
The new insurance policy will clarify key definitions, standardize policy language, and expand coverage scope—specifically including consumer-funded upgrades to adv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) and hardware/software damages arising from emerging scenarios such as human-machine collaborative driving.
